AI Technical Summary

Technical Problem

Traditional locks are easily opened accidentally by external forces such as vibration in mobile environments, and their status cannot be monitored in real time, affecting the user experience and security.

Method used

Design an electronically visualized push-button lock that achieves self-locking through the cooperation of an L-shaped locking block and a rotating locking rod, and displays the lock status in real time through limit switches and a display system.

Benefits of technology

It prevents cabinets and drawers from opening accidentally in mobile environments, and allows users to intuitively judge the status of the locks, avoiding misoperation and improving security and convenience.

Abstract

According to the electronic visual pressing type lockset, a hook enters a locking inlet of a lock shell to be connected with an L-shaped locking block in a clamped mode, a rotating lock rod and a semi-cylindrical contact head at the end of a sliding sleeve of the rotating lock rod are driven to interact with a rotating contact part of the L-shaped locking block, and downward rotation of a locking part and self-locking of the locking part and the hook are achieved; and the lock is prevented from being accidentally opened in a moving environment. In the locking process, the trigger rotates along with the rotating seat to trigger the limiting switch, and the external display system displays the locking state; and during unlocking, the display system displays an open state, so that a user can conveniently judge the state of the lock, and the situation that the drawer is not closed in place due to misoperation is avoided. In addition, a mistaken touch prevention function is designed, and when the locking part of the L-shaped locking block is mistakenly touched, the pressing angle of the locking part abuts against the front end of the cover plate, and the locking block is prevented from further rotating. In the unlocking state, the opening of the lock cover is shielded by the L-shaped lock block and the cover plate, and foreign matter is prevented from entering and affecting structure operation. According to the lock, through self-locking and false touch prevention state visual design, safety and user convenience are improved.

TECHNICAL FIELD

[0001] The present application relates to the technical field of locks, in particular to an electronic visual push-type lock. BACKGROUND

[0002] In daily life, cabinets and drawers are common storage devices in houses, usually designed with folding doors or sliding doors to achieve convenient opening and closing functions. To meet the convenience of daily use, such cabinets and drawers are usually not locked. In a stationary indoor environment, these designs can effectively maintain the closed state and will not automatically open, thus meeting the basic use requirements.

[0003] However, in mobile environments such as cars, trains and airplanes, due to external forces such as vibration and inertia, these traditional cabinets and drawers are prone to accidental opening during operation, resulting in damage to stored items, and even potential safety hazards to personnel. Therefore, in these special scenarios, higher performance requirements are placed on the locks of cabinets and drawers, which not only need to ensure the closing reliability in mobile environments, but also need to consider the opening and closing convenience in daily use.

[0004] In the prior art, mechanical locks or other fixing devices are usually installed to prevent cabinets and drawers from accidentally opening. However, the use of these traditional locks is relatively cumbersome, increasing the operation complexity and affecting the use experience of cabinets and drawers. In addition, these locks are mainly mechanical structures and cannot realize real-time monitoring of the state of cabinets or drawers. For example, in some scenarios, users cannot determine whether the lock is in a locked or unlocked state, or whether the drawer is not closed in place due to a misoperation, which may further increase the safety hazards.

[0005] To solve the above problems, an electronic visual push-type lock is proposed. CONTENT OF THE INVENTION

[0018] In order to make the content of the present application more easily understood, the technical solutions in the embodiments of the present application will be clearly and completely described below in conjunction with the drawings in the embodiments of the present application. It should be noted that the words "front", "back", "left", "right", "up" and "down" used in the following description refer to the directions in the drawings, and the words "inner" and "outer" refer to the directions towards or away from the geometric center of a specific component. Figure 1

[0019] As Figures 1-2 ​As shown, an electronic visual push type lock includes a lock body 1 and a hook 2, the lock body 1 includes a lock shell 3, an L-shaped lock block 4 and a rotating lock rod 5, the lock shell 3 is a square structure and one side of which is provided with an opening, the inside of the lock shell 3 is rotatably connected with the middle part of the L-shaped lock block 4 at the upper position of the other side, specifically, the upper end of the L-shaped lock block 4 is a locking part 9 which can be clamped and locked with the hook 2, the lower end of the L-shaped lock block 4 is a rotating contact part 10 which is a semicylindrical groove, the middle part of the L-shaped lock block 4 is provided with a pressing angle 11; the inside of the lock shell 3 is rotatably connected with one end of the rotating lock rod 5 at the lower position of the other side, the rotating lock rod 5 is a flexible structure, specifically, the rotating lock rod 5 includes a rotating seat 12, a fixed rod 13, a supporting sleeve 14 and a spring 15, the outside of the rotating seat 12 is rotatably connected with the inside of the lock shell 3 at the lower position of the other side, the rotating seat 12 is fixedly provided with the fixed rod 13, the supporting sleeve 14 is slidably sleeved on the fixed rod 13, the end of the supporting sleeve 14 is a semicylindrical contact head 16 which is matched with the semicylindrical groove of the rotating contact part 10 in shape and size, the semicylindrical contact head 16 is rotatably connected with the rotating contact part 10, the supporting sleeve 14 is externally sleeved with the spring 15, the two ends of the spring 15 are respectively supported on the semicylindrical contact head 16 and the rotating seat 12; the upper position of the rotating lock rod 5 is provided with a cover plate 7, one end of the cover plate 7 is fixedly connected with the rotating seat 12, the other end of the cover plate 7 is an active end which does not interfere with the supporting sleeve 14; the rotating seat 12 is fixedly provided with a trigger 18 at the lower side, a communication groove 17 is formed through the side wall of the lock shell 3 at the position corresponding to the trigger 18, an installation box 20 is fixedly provided on the side wall of the lock shell 3 at the position corresponding to the communication groove 17, a limit switch 19 is fixedly installed in the installation box 20, the limit switch 19 is electrically connected with an external display system, the other side of the communication groove 17 is provided with the limit switch 19; when the lock body 1 and the hook 2 are in a separated state, the front end of the cover plate 7 supports the inclined surface of the pressing angle 11 in an inclined upward direction, so that the L-shaped lock block 4 remains in an everted state, the trigger 18 does not trigger the limit switch 19, and the external display system displays that the lock is in an open state; when the lock body 1 and the hook 2 are in a clamped state, the elastic end of the rotating lock rod 5 is supported on the rotating contact part 10 under the action of the elastic force, so that the locking part 9 is clamped with the hook 2, the sharp part of the pressing angle 11 presses the upper side of the cover plate 7 downward to bend and press the elastic end of the rotating lock rod 5 to realize self-locking; the other side of the inside of the lock shell 3 is a locking entrance 8, the hook 2 can enter the lock shell 3 from the locking entrance 8 to be clamped with the lock body 1, at the same time, the trigger 18 can pass through the communication groove 17 and trigger the limit switch 19 with the rotation of the rotating seat 12, so that the external display system displays that the lock is in a closed state;

[0020] Working principle: when the lock body 1 is connected with the hook 2, the hook 2 enters from the locking entrance 8 of the lock shell 3 and hits the locking part 9 of the L-shaped lock block 4 and the cover plate 7 on the upper side of the rotating lock rod 5, so that the front end of the cover plate 7 is separated from the pressing angle 11 of the L-shaped lock block 4, and then the rotating seat 12 of the cover plate 7 drives the rotating lock rod 5 to rotate downward, and then the semicylindrical contact head 16 at the end of the rotating lock rod 5 is in contact with the rotating contact part 10 of the L-shaped lock block 4, so that the locking part 9 of the L-shaped lock block 4 rotates downward and is connected with the hook 2, and the semicylindrical contact head 16 is pressed against the rotating contact part 10 under the elastic force of the spring 15, so that the L-shaped lock block 4 is not outwardly turned, the locking part 9 is kept connected with the hook 2, and the tip of the pressing angle 11 of the L-shaped lock block 4 presses the upper side of the cover plate 7 downward to bend and press the semicylindrical contact head 16 to realize self-locking, so that the cabinet, drawer or the like provided with the lock can be prevented from being accidentally opened in a moving environment; at the same time, the trigger 18 rotates through the communication groove 17 along with the rotating seat 12 and triggers the limit switch 19, so that the external display system displays that the lock is in a locked state; when the lock body 1 is separated from the hook 2, the trigger 18 does not trigger the limit switch 19, and at this time the external display system displays that the lock is in an open state, so that the user can more directly and effectively observe and judge whether the lock is in a locked or unlocked state, and the drawer is prevented from being not closed in place due to misoperation; in addition, when the lock body 1 is separated from the hook 2, if the locking part 9 of the L-shaped lock block 4 is accidentally touched, the L-shaped lock block 4 has a downward rotating trend, at this time the pressing angle 11 of the L-shaped lock block 4 hits the front end of the cover plate 7 on the upper side of the rotating lock rod 5, and then the L-shaped lock block 4 cannot continue to rotate downward, so as to achieve the effect of preventing accidental touch; in addition, when the lock body 1 is separated from the hook 2, the opening of the lock shell is shielded by the L-shaped lock block 4 and the cover plate 7 on the upper side of the rotating lock rod 5, so that foreign matters cannot enter the inside of the lock shell, and the structure of the lock body 1 is prevented from being affected.
